Documentation for Face Intellect 7.1. Documentation for other versions of Intellect is available too.

Previous page Next page

POST http://localhost:10000/firserver/ReadPersons

JSON parameters:

{
 "server_id": "1",
 "objectType": "PERSON",
 "id": [

 ],
 "page": 1,
 "pageSize": 2
}

where 

  • server_id - ID of the Face Recognition Server in the Face-Intellect software package (see the Configuring the Face Recognition Server object)
  • id - if empty, the response will return all users' info with paging
  • page, pageSize - paging parameters.

Example of response:

{
 "PersonList": [
 {
 "Id": "188ECB8F-1137-E711-9E4B-9C5C8E763A8F",
 "Name": "Friske",
 "Surname": "Jeanna",
 "Patronymic": "",
 "Department": "Department 1",
 "Comment": "",
 "Timestamp": "2017-05-12T12:50:30.378",
 "ImageId": "1B8ECB8F-1137-E711-9E4B-9C5C8E763A8F"
 },
 {
 "Id": "148ECB8F-1137-E711-9E4B-9C5C8E763A8F",
 "Name": "Smath",
 "Surname": "William",
 "Patronymic": "",
 "Department": "Department 1",
 "Comment": "",
 "Timestamp": "2017-05-12T12:50:30.368",
 "ImageId": "158ECB8F-1137-E711-9E4B-9C5C8E763A8F"
 },
 {
 "Id": "198ECB8F-1137-E711-9E4B-9C5C8E763A8F",
 "Name": "Snipes",
 "Surname": "Wesley",
 "Patronymic": "",
 "Department": "Department 1",
 "Comment": "",
 "Timestamp": "2017-05-12T12:50:30.358",
 "ImageId": "1A8ECB8F-1137-E711-9E4B-9C5C8E763A8F"
 }
 ],
 "Total": 220,
 "Responce": {
 "Status": "OK"
 }
}

where:  

  • PersonList.ImageId - image ID

Note

Users are listed in the response in order of time of their adding to the database (last added at first).

Note

Using the identifier from PersonList.ImageId parameter, you can get the user's photo with a separate query. See Getting image by ID.

  • No labels